Pishiko Media Announces Partnership for Children’s Meditation Series

0

Pishiko Media partners with acclaimed artists Huascar Barradas and Vanessa Montilla to create a children’s mindfulness and audiobook series promoting empathy and emotional growth.

Miami, United States, 12th Nov 2025 – Pishiko Media, led by entrepreneur and children’s rights advocate Yanet Pájaro, has partnered with award-winning flutist and composer Huascar Barradas and sound engineer and wellness promoter Vanessa Montilla to produce an innovative children’s meditation and audiobook series. The upcoming project, scheduled for release in Fall 2026, integrates original compositions, immersive soundscapes, and storytelling to nurture emotional intelligence, empathy, and mindfulness among young listeners.

The series will include a music album, interactive digital experiences, and a children’s storybook that collectively encourage emotional development and social awareness. Each component is designed to foster core values such as curiosity, respect, and friendship through creative engagement.

The Power of Sound: Collaboration with Visionary Artists

Huascar Barradas, @huascarbarradas, a Latin GRAMMY Award-winning flutist and composer, brings decades of experience in classical and world music to the project. His compositions will blend traditional orchestration with world rhythms, offering children an emotional and sensory journey through sound.

“Music is a powerful tool for connection, and when crafted thoughtfully, it can support children in learning about empathy, curiosity, and friendship,” said Barradas. “This collaboration blends classical music with global rhythms to guide children through important life lessons.”

Sound engineer and producer Vanessa Montilla, recognized for her work with Cirque du Soleil and the Venezuelan Simón Bolívar Symphony Orchestra, contributes her expertise in sound therapy and emotional wellness. “Sound can affect our mental and emotional states in profound ways,” Montilla noted. “This project combines classical music, global rhythms, and healing frequencies to create an immersive experience that supports emotional well-being.”
